INDIA eased to a 95-run victory over Middlesex at Lord’s ahead of the one-day series against England next week.
Captain for the day Virat Kohli scored his first half-century of the summer with 71 as the tourists made 230 all out after 44.2 overs.
Kohli shared a fourth-wicket stand of 104 with Ambati Rayudu (72) despite off-spinner Ollie Rayner taking 4-32.
Middlesex had their hopes of victory dashed as they collapsed to 135 all out from 40 overs as Karn Sharma took 3-14.
It was a morale-boosting win for India still smarting from a 3-1 Test defeat to England.
But their only warm-up one-day match before the One Day International series against England starts on Monday will not count as a List A win because India were given permission to use their whole squad in the field.
The first of five ODIs takes place at Bristol on August 25. (BBC Sport)
